Pergola sealing services involve applying specialized protective coatings to the surface of a pergola to prevent damage caused by exposure to the elements. This process typically includes cleaning the structure thoroughly, inspecting for any existing issues, and then sealing the wood or other materials with a weather-resistant finish. Proper sealing helps to preserve the appearance of the pergola while extending its lifespan, making it a practical maintenance step for homeowners looking to protect their outdoor investment.

Sealing a pergola addresses common problems such as wood rot, warping, cracking, and fading. Without adequate protection, exposure to moisture, sunlight, and temperature fluctuations can accelerate deterioration. By sealing the surface, service providers help create a barrier that minimizes water infiltration, reduces the effects of UV rays, and prevents the growth of mold and mildew. This maintenance work can significantly reduce the need for costly repairs or replacements over time.

The overview below groups typical Pergola Sealing proj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for routine sealing of minor cracks or gaps in pergolas generally range from $250 to $600. Many standard maintenance jobs fall within this band, depending on the size and condition of the structure.

Partial Sealing - For larger sections or partial sealing projects, local contractors often charge between $600 and $1,500. These projects are common for pergolas that require more extensive sealing to protect against weathering.

Full Pergola Sealing - Complete sealing of an entire pergola usually costs between $1,500 and $3,500. Many homeowners opt for this when upgrading or restoring older structures, with fewer projects exceeding this range.

Full Replacement - Larger, more complex pergola sealing or replacement projects can reach $5,000 or more. These are less common and typically involve significant structural work or custom materials.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is pergola sealing? Pergola sealing involves applying a protective coating to guard the structure against moisture, weather damage, and wear.

Why should I consider sealing my pergola? Sealing helps prolong the lifespan of a pergola by preventing water penetration, rot, and other types of damage caused by exposure to the elements.

What types of sealants are used for pergolas? Local contractors typically use sealants such as waterproofing stains, acrylic or polyurethane coatings, and specialized wood sealers to protect pergolas.

How often does a pergola need to be resealed? The frequency of resealing depends on the type of sealant used and environmental conditions, but many recommend reapplying every 1 to 3 years for optimal protection.

Can a pergola be sealed if it is already showing signs of damage? Yes, a professional service provider can assess the condition of the pergola and determine if sealing is appropriate or if repairs are needed before sealing.
